Description
It could happen to you! The judicial system has been on a downward spiral due to overzealous prosecutors, entitled judges, and privatization within the incarceration "industry." It is no longer "innocent until proven guilty," as much as it is a contest between two lawyers to see who reigns supreme. The defendants have become pawns in a giant game. Finances, not facts, often determine the outcome of cases.
In my story, Sean West finds himself in the midst of such impropriety. Accused of sexual misconduct that he insists never happened, it triggers a series of events that forever changes his life. When a 15 year-old girl steps forward with allegations of abuse, Mr. West has confidence that the judicial system will discover the truth and make the correct decision regarding his future. A judge who berates lawyers, a defense attorney obviously frightened by the judge and a prosecutor with a penchant for trying people with weak evidence turns Sean's trial into a circus. Sean finds that his faith in the judicial system was sorely mistaken as the trial plays out before him. Rather than a search for the truth, it becomes a mission to re-arrange the facts to fit the prosecutor's agenda.
A Motion for Innocence...And Justice for All? is a revealing story about the reality of justice in America today. Written in first person, this book takes the listener on a journey through the court system and beyond. It is emotional, traumatic and real. If you think it cannot happen to you, think again.
